How they compare

France currently reports 7,855 1000 USD against 487 1000 USD in Belgium, a difference of 7,368 1000 USD.

That makes France's figure about 16.1 times Belgium's.

Across all 16 years both countries report, France has been ahead every year.

Belgium ranks 4th and France ranks 2nd of 33 countries.

France has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
